Output e706437716ae34b9ce27f27fc8d819b66178837b77f072fd41a5a1c95294d616:0

value
1037203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c666131f70002a5c65b999bbd903850c43c133f1 OP_EQUALVERIFY OP_CHECKSIG
address
1K635FtuAZhuPiTb3TeoP7VPnxQekdVkpP
transaction
e706437716ae34b9ce27f27fc8d819b66178837b77f072fd41a5a1c95294d616
spent
true